Mercedes admit scoring 2020 ‘classic own goal'
Mercedes technical director James Allison has revealed the team scored a “classic own goal” in the 70th Anniversary Grand Prix at Silverstone. The second of the two F1 races held in Britain during the 2020 season was a rare one in which the World Champions were on the back foot, beaten by Max Verstappen’s Red Bull. The reason was the greater tyre wear on Lewis Hamilton and Valtteri Bottas’ cars, following the issues that had materialised a week earlier in the British Grand Prix.
